BETTENDORF, Iowa (KWQC) - A music festival benefitting King’s Harvest Pet Rescue is coming to Bettendorf.

The “Rescue Rocks” music festival will feature live music, food and drinks, a silent auction and adoptable animals from King’s Harvest, according to a media release.

The event is free, but organizers will be accepting donations that will go directly to the animal shelter.

“We are thrilled to host the Rescue Rocks Music Festival at the Tangled Wood and support the incredible work of King’s Harvest Pet Rescue,” Joe Janz, the event organizer, said in the release. “This festival is not just about enjoying great music; it’s about making a difference in the lives of animals who need our help.”

The festival is from 2 p.m. to 10 p.m. on Sept. 13 at the Tangled Wood in Bettendorf.
